Where to watch free German TV online — both for native speakers and language learners — including streaming platforms, apps, and YouTube channels with full episodes.
You don't need a German TV subscription to access hundreds of hours of authentic German content. Several platforms offer free German TV streaming legally — here's the complete list.
ARD Mediathek (ardmediathek.de) is the free streaming platform of Germany's main public broadcaster. Available in Germany without restriction; accessible elsewhere with a VPN. Thousands of hours of content: news, dramas, documentaries, talk shows. Deutsche Welle's international content streams free worldwide without a VPN. ARD runs Tagesschau (evening news) daily on YouTube — full episodes, German captions, free globally.
ZDF Mediathek (zdf.de) is Germany's second public broadcaster. Their drama catalogue includes Terra X documentaries (excellent for learners — clear narration, interesting topics). Some content is geo-restricted to Germany but a significant library streams worldwide. ZDF is particularly strong for factual content and political programmes.
Deutsche Welle (dw.com) is Germany's international broadcaster and is designed for global streaming — no VPN required, no subscription. DW produces content in German at slow (learner) speed and also publishes full episodes of German series for learning. The language learning section has free A1-C1 courses with video content.
YouTube has thousands of hours of authentic German content: full episodes uploaded by German channels, language learning channels (Easy German, Learn German with Anja), German vlogs, cooking shows, and news. Joyn (joyn.de) is a free German streaming platform with ProSieben, Sat.1, and kabel eins content. Reality TV, talk shows, entertainment — authentic German content at natural speed. Some content requires a German IP address but the platform is free. Good for pop culture German — the kind of vocabulary that doesn't appear in news or drama.
